Hannover is renowned for its magnificent Herrenhausen Gardens, historical Old Town, and as a former royal residence with strong ties to the British monarchy. During the Christmas season, the city gains fame for its picturesque Christmas market, which transforms the Old Town into a romantic, festively lit wonderland, blending its rich history with seasonal charm.
The "Red Thread" is a popular self-guided walking tour in Hannover, marked by a red line painted on the pavement throughout the city center. It leads visitors to 36 significant historical and cultural landmarks, including the New Town Hall, the Old Town with its half-timbered houses, and the Marktkirche. It's an excellent way to independently explore Hannover's key attractions.
Visitors can best navigate Hannover on foot, especially in the compact city center and Old Town where the Christmas markets are located. For longer distances, Hannover boasts an efficient public transport system including trams, buses, and the S-Bahn. Consider purchasing a day ticket for convenience if you plan to explore beyond the central walking areas.
Public transport in Hannover is generally paid. Passengers are required to purchase tickets for all modes of transportation, including trams, buses, and the S-Bahn. Various ticket options are available, such as single fares, day tickets, and multi-day passes, which can be acquired from vending machines at stops or through mobile apps.

Yes, "Hanover" and "Hannover" both refer to the same German city. "Hannover" is the official German spelling, predominantly used within Germany and by German speakers. "Hanover" is the anglicized spelling, commonly used in English-speaking countries. Both terms are widely understood when referring to the capital of Lower Saxony.
